Runbook note for the eng sync — reset-flow revamp (project Rekey)

Quick recap: we've swapped the old emailed-link reset for the new short-lived challenge flow. Rollout is behind the RESET_V2 flag, currently at 25% on the Fernbright cluster. If you're standing up a test box, copy env.sample, flip RESET_V2 on, and set the token-signing secret — it goes on the line right after this sentence.

vault entry, bagep-yahip: VAULT_KEY8=d2a227e5

For branch managers.

The finance committee reviewed the launch plan for the Orvane product line. Projected first-year revenue stands within budgeted range, with break-even expected in month fourteen. Marketing spend is front-loaded into the first two quarters; branch-level promotional budgets remain unchanged. Inventory staging begins at the Caldermoor warehouse next month. Branches should hold current staffing levels until sell-through data arrives. The committee also recorded the following planning note:

management briefing: Only 5 of the 80 pilot accounts renewed Zorix, so a churn review is set for October 1.

## Further Reading

This section covers background material for the Quillback queue-depth autoscaler. The scaling decision loop, cooldown windows, and the difference between depth-based and latency-based triggers are explained in the design notes maintained by the Harrowfield platform team. Before escalating a scaling complaint, check the autoscaler decision log described on the internal page here:

operations page: https://jenkins.zemvarcloud.local/job/merge_requests/repo/build/73930b4b30f0a8ed